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a drainage pump ranges from $1,200 to $3,500, depending on the system size and complexity. Larger or more advanced systems tend to be on the higher end of the spectrum.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Material Expenses - Material costs for drainage pumps generally fall between $300 and $1,200, including pumps, pipes, and fittings. The choice of materials and brand influences the overall expense. Pros can help select suitable options within the desired budget.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for drainage pump installation typically range from $500 to $2,000, depending on site conditions and installation difficulty. Additional work such as trenching or site preparation may increase costs. Local contractors offer quotes tailored to individual projects.
Maintenance & Upkeep - Routine maintenance services for drainage pumps usually cost between $100 and $400 annually. Proper upkeep can extend the lifespan of the system and prevent costly repairs. Service providers can assist with ongoing maintenance plans.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
